The Accounting Manager will lead and manage key month-end and quarter-end close activities across operational accounting areas, including cash, fixed assets, accruals, and other general accounting functions.
This role will oversee close execution, review team deliverables, and help drive scalable and efficient accounting operations in a fast-paced, high-growth environment.
The ideal candidate brings strong close management experience, sound accounting judgment, and the ability to lead a team through complex and evolving business needs while maintaining high quality and operational discipline.
Responsibilities
Lead and manage month-end and quarter-end close activities across cash, fixed assets, accruals, and other operational accounting areas
Review journal entries, account reconciliations, flux analyses, and supporting schedules to ensure accuracy and completeness
Manage and develop a team of accountants, providing coaching, prioritization support, and performance feedback
Drive close execution and ensure deliverables are completed timely and accurately
Partner cross-functionally with FP&A, Treasury, AP, Procurement, IT, and other business stakeholders
Identify process improvement and automation opportunities to enhance scalability and reduce manual work
Support implementation and optimization of accounting systems, controls, and operational workflows
Maintain strong documentation, controls, and audit readiness across owned processes
Support quarter-end reporting and analytical review processes
Participate in transformation and operational excellence initiatives as the company continues to scale
